1. Battleground Mobile India (BGMI) Best Game Like Free Fire

Formerly known as PUBG Mobile India, it was developed exclusively for Indians after banning Chinese apps. You must have played it or the PUBG. It’s a shooting game where you have to fight against another player. The game consists of 100 players battling together to stay till the end of the game to win.

You can enter the game the way you want like you could enter individually or in a group of 4. Before the match (game) starts, every player lands on six islands. The islands include Erangel, Miramar, Sanhok,Vikendi, Livik, and Karakin. Every player’s path is different to land, so, while the journey, they’ve to quickly figure out the best time to get out with a parachute. 

After landing, you’ve to look for essential places like apartments and mysterious homes to look out for arms and ammunition. In the beginning, these are evenly distributed at several locations; however, some higher risks zones have them in abundance. You can mentor yourself either from the first-person perspective or the third-person perspective. However, it would be best if you decided on it as per your gameplay and convenience as both of them have their pros and cons.

2. PUBG New State

Launched a few months ago, it’s a development to the PUBG: Battlegrounds. It’s modern-day gameplay that will provide you with the best gaming experience. It’s one of the most loved virtual ground-battle games. Herein, 100 players would jump out of an airplane to land on the island called “Troi,” that’s its main game map. Here, you grab the weapons and defend yourself by killing each other to stay alive by the end of the match.

The one alive wins the game. The game is also equipped with futuristic developments like drones, ballistic shields, reviving dead teammates, and lots more to give an out-of-the-box gaming experience to all its users. By choosing your ideal perspective, you get to play it well! Developed by PUBG Studios and published by Kraftan, the game is available for Android and iOS phones. Its mobile version is rich in graphics and interface. Indulge into its richness and fight through all odds to win the battle.

3. Call of Duty

It’s another famous and popular shooting game in India. From the Cold to World War, the game will give you a real-time experience on your smartphones. Besides, the game has several twists and turns that make the game extraordinary. You could play it on your affordable smartphones without compromising the gameplay quality. The game can be played on Android, Blackberry, iOS; besides, you can use it for several PlayStation and Xbox gaming consoles.

It’s a conventional multiplayer game still giving you the best gaming experience by its fantastic gaming modes. These modes include Kill Confirmed, Team Deathmatch, and Domination upon classic maps like Standoff, Shipment, and Raid. Though being a conventional shooting game, its 3D graphics help you to have a rich gaming experience.

Moreover, it takes care that its players don’t feel bored. Yes, you heard it right; for the same, it keeps on releasing new game modes. For playing like a pro, you need to unlock avatars, weapons, and several modes. However, this makes the game challenging, and you have an addictive gaming experience. Along with that, its newer seasons and terrific shooting experience make it worth playing.

6. Fortnite

It’s a FreeFire alternative game that uses building and shooting mechanics, where players are put against each other in a last-man-standing deathmatch. The game was released in 2017. It was developed by People Can Fly and Epic Games. The game is available for both Android and iOS and it is one of ‘the biggest game in the world.’ In 2019, Fortnite had 250 million players worldwide and had generated over $1 billion in revenue since its release.

It is an online game that requires you to be in two teams to complete missions. You can construct defensive structures and fortifications around them as they play. The game has an animated over-the-top visual style, similar to the art style of Splatoon. It has been praised for its replayability, with reviewers attributing this to the combination of its building system, destructible environments, and combat mechanics.

Overall, the game offers free to play battle royale games mode that includes 100 players. The last man standing will win the game. You will be able to use weapons found on the map or from treasure chests scattered across the map to fight with your opponents.
